>Details: It turns out, Flickr's data can only be loaded in pages
> of up to 100. So when there are more than 100 results,
> it's broken up into separate XML pages that have to be
> individually requested. So I added in a bunch of stuff
> to facilitate this, where if you get to the end of one
> list, it will request the next list when you move to the
> right. This results in a rather insubstantial bit of
> loading time while we switch between sheets. I added a
> text field that temporarily replaces the image counter
> in the lower right-hand side that appears during this
> loading time, to indicate that it's getting the next 100
> or previous 100 (if you're going backward).
>
> In doing so, I also made it so you can't scroll beyond
> the 100 in each list, which fixes one of the other bugs.
>
> Meanwhile, I noticed and fixed a few minor glitches while
> I was in there (like if you search for a new term, the
> search results come in starting at the image number
> where you'd left off in the previous search), and
> a couple other minor things (misplaced text, etc).
